当前位置:首页 > uni-app

uniapp强大的插件

2026-03-05 13:45:57uni-app

uniapp 常用插件推荐

UI组件库

  • uView UI:多平台兼容的高性能组件库,提供丰富的UI组件和工具,支持自定义主题。
  • uni-ui:官方推出的高性能组件库,专为uniapp优化,包含常用组件如轮播图、下拉刷新等。

图表插件

  • ucharts:跨平台图表库,支持折线图、柱状图、饼图等,性能优越且配置灵活。
  • f2:阿里开源的移动端可视化方案,适配uniapp,适合复杂数据展示。

动画插件

  • animate.css:CSS动画库,通过类名快速实现动画效果,轻量易用。
  • wow.js:滚动动画库,支持元素进入视口时触发动画。

实用工具插件

网络请求增强

  • luch-request:基于Promise的请求库,支持拦截器、超时设置等,替代原生uni.request。
  • flyio:轻量级HTTP库,支持请求/响应拦截,兼容浏览器和Node环境。

状态管理

uniapp强大的插件

  • pinia:轻量级状态管理库,Vue3推荐替代Vuex的方案,支持TypeScript。
  • vuex:官方状态管理工具,适合复杂应用的状态共享。

跨平台适配插件

原生功能扩展

  • uni-native:封装原生功能如摄像头、GPS,提供统一API调用。
  • nativeplugins:第三方原生插件市场,涵盖支付、推送等模块。

多端编译优化

  • uni-stat:官方统计插件,支持各平台数据埋点和分析。
  • uni-mp-router:小程序路由增强插件,解决原生路由限制问题。

性能优化插件

图片处理

uniapp强大的插件

  • uni-image-tools:图片压缩、懒加载工具,减少资源消耗。
  • lazy-load:可视化区域懒加载组件,提升长列表性能。

缓存管理

  • uni-storage:本地存储增强插件,支持加密和过期时间设置。
  • cache-manager:多级缓存管理,整合内存、本地存储等策略。

开发辅助插件

调试工具

  • vconsole:移动端调试面板,支持日志、网络请求查看。
  • eruda:手机端开发者工具,提供元素检查、性能分析功能。

代码生成

  • uni-create:快速生成页面/组件模板,支持自定义预设。
  • uni-helper:VSCode插件,提供API智能提示和语法校验。

注意事项

  • 插件兼容性需根据项目使用的uniapp版本选择。
  • 部分插件可能需要额外配置或申请平台权限(如微信小程序)。
  • 性能敏感场景建议测试后再集成,避免过度依赖插件影响包体积。

标签: 插件强大
分享给朋友:

相关文章

vue插件实现原理

vue插件实现原理

Vue 插件实现原理 Vue 插件的核心是通过扩展 Vue 的功能,提供全局或实例级别的能力。插件可以添加全局方法、指令、混入(mixin)、组件等。 插件的基本结构 一个 Vue 插件通常是一个对…

vue实现插件功能

vue实现插件功能

Vue 插件实现方法 安装与注册插件 在 Vue 项目中,插件通常以独立模块形式存在。通过 Vue.use() 方法注册插件,该方法会自动调用插件的 install 函数。 // 引入插件 imp…

uniapp 路由插件

uniapp 路由插件

在UniApp中,路由管理通常依赖框架内置的页面跳转API,但若需要更高级的路由功能(如动态路由、拦截器等),可通过以下插件或方案实现: 路由插件推荐 uni-simple-router 专为Uni…

vue表单检验插件实现

vue表单检验插件实现

Vue 表单验证插件实现 Vue 表单验证可以通过多种方式实现,包括使用第三方插件或自定义验证逻辑。以下是几种常见的方法: 使用 VeeValidate 插件 VeeValidate 是一个流行的…

vue安装插件的实现

vue安装插件的实现

vue安装插件的实现方式 在Vue中安装插件通常通过Vue.use()方法实现,插件可以扩展Vue的功能,添加全局方法或属性、添加全局资源、注入组件选项等。 插件的基本结构 一个Vue插件通常是一个…

vue实现拖拽的插件

vue实现拖拽的插件

vue-draggable 基于Sortable.js封装,适用于Vue 2/3的拖拽排序组件,支持列表、表格、跨容器拖拽。 安装 npm install vuedraggable 基本用…